问题重现 [root@ltd kub]# kubectl create -f mysql-rc.yaml replicationcontroller "mysql" created [root@ltd...kub]# kubectl get rc NAME DESIRED CURRENT READY AGE mysql 1 0 0...4s [root@ltd kub]# kubectl get pods No resources found....LimitRanger,SecurityContextDeny,ServiceAccount,ResourceQuota" #去掉ServiceAccount,保存 再看: [root@ltd ~]# kubectl...get pods NAME READY STATUS RESTARTS AGE mysql-36gjv 1/1 Running 0
kubectl describe pod PODS_Name 报错信息 Error syncing pod, skipping: failed to “StartContainer” for “POD.../etc/rhsm/ca/redhat-uep.pem | tee /etc/rhsm/ca/redhat-uep.pem [root@localhost ~]# kubectl delete -f
在我学习的过程中,我会创建很多临时的 Pods,测试完其实这些 Pods 就没用了,或者说 Status 是 Error 或者 Complete 的 Pods 已经不是我学习的对象,想删掉,所以 kubectl...get pods 的时候想显示少一点。...alias getComplete="kubectl get pods | grep Completed | awk -F ' ' '{print $1}'" alias getError="kubectl...get pods | grep Error | awk -F ' ' '{print $1}'" grep 和 awk 不熟悉的同学请千万不要去百度谷歌,因为这样会造成依赖,每次一用就去搜,用完过几天就忘...| xargs kubectl delete pods pod "group-by-test-1560763907118-driver" deleted pod "hdfs-test-driver"
返回结果的 HTTP 状态码.png 返回结果的 HTTP 状态码 状态码的职责 当客户端向服务器端发送请求时,描述返回的请求结果 状态码的大致分类 1XX 信息性状态码 · 接收的请求正在处理 2XX...204 No Content 该状态码代表服务器接收的请求已成功处理,但在返回的响应报文中不含实体的主体部分 206 Partial Content 该状态码表示客户端进行了范围请求,而服务器成功执行了这部分的...GET 请求 3XX 重定向 301 Moved Permanently 永久性重定向。...该状态码表示请求的资源已被分配了新的 URI,希望用户(本次)能使用新的 URI 访问 303 See Other 该状态码表示由于请求对应的资源存在着另一个 URI,应使用 GET 方法定向获取请求的资源...303 状态码和 302 Found 状态码有着相同的功能,但 303 状态码明确表示客户端应当采用 GET 方法获取资 源 304 Not Modified 该状态码表示客户端发送附带条件的请求 2
函数即是重复代码的克星,也是对抗代码复杂度的最佳武器。如同大部分故事都会有结局,绝大多数函数也都是以返回结果作为结束。函数返回结果的手法,决定了调用它时的体验。...所以,了解如何优雅的让函数返回结果,是编写好函数的必备知识。Python 的函数返回方式Python 函数通过调用 return 语句来返回结果。...一切都由一个函数 get_users 来搞定。这样的设计似乎很合理。然而在函数的世界里,以编写具备“多功能”的瑞士军刀型函数为荣不是一件好事。...像上面的例子,我们应该编写两个独立的函数 get_user_by_id(user_id)、 get_active_users()来替代。2....抛出异常,而不是返回结果与错误我在前面提过,Python 里的函数可以返回多个值。基于这个能力,我们可以编写一类特殊的函数:同时返回结果与错误信息的函数。
如同大部分故事都会有结局,绝大多数函数也都是以返回结果作为结束。函数返回结果的手法,决定了调用它时的体验。所以,了解如何优雅的让函数返回结果,是编写好函数的必备知识。...Python 的函数返回方式 Python 函数通过调用 return 语句来返回结果。...else: return User.filter(is_active=True)# 返回单个用户get_users(user_id=1)# 返回多个用户get_users() 当我们需要获取单个用户时...像上面的例子,我们应该编写两个独立的函数 get_user_by_id(user_id)、 get_active_users()来替代。 2....抛出异常,而不是返回结果与错误 我在前面提过,Python 里的函数可以返回多个值。基于这个能力,我们可以编写一类特殊的函数:同时返回结果与错误信息的函数。
有时候我们需要展示一些内容,如果等所有内容都加载完毕再展示这样反而会降低用户体验; 因为如果消耗时间长那么用户需要瞪着空白的页面,反而会失去兴趣; 所以我们希望加载一点资源显示一点,对于那么超过我们容忍范围还未加载完毕的资源我们应该...不再去加载,放弃本次加载或者显示一些默认结果 模拟: final Random r = new Random(); // 创建一个固定大小的线程池 ExecutorService...es = Executors.newFixedThreadPool(10); // 将所有处理结果提交到一个固定大小的队列(可不指定,默认创建一个无界队列) ExecutorCompletionService...Thread.sleep(l); return Thread.currentThread().getName() + "|" + l; } }); try { //获得返回结果...,3s超时(表示我们能够容忍的最大等待时间) System.out.println(ecs.take().get(3, TimeUnit.SECONDS)); } catch
函数返回结果的手法,决定了调用它时的体验。所以,了解如何优雅的让函数返回结果,是编写好函数的必备知识。 Python 函数通过调用 return 语句来返回结果。...: return User.filter(is_active=True) # 返回单个用户 get_users(user_id=1) # 返回多个用户 get_users() 当我们需要获取单个用户时...像上面的例子,我们应该编写两个独立的函数 get_user_by_id(user_id)、 get_active_users()来替代。 2....抛出异常,而不是返回结果与错误 我在前面提过,Python 里的函数可以返回多个值。基于这个能力,我们可以编写一类特殊的函数:同时返回结果与错误信息的函数。...对这类函数来说,使用 None 作为“没结果”时的返回值也是合理的。
2、函数需要先定义后调用,函数体中return语句的结果就是返回值。如果一个函数没有reutrn语句,其实它有一个隐含的return语句,返回值是None,类型也是’NoneType’。...def func(x,y): num = x + y return print(func(1,2)) #上面代码的输出结果为:None 从上面例子可以看出print( )只是起一个打印作用,函数具体返回什么由...def showplus(x): print(x) return x + 1 num = showplus(6) add = num + 2 print(add) #上面函数的输出结果为:6、9 实例扩展...: 返回简单值 下面来看一个函数,它接受名和姓并返回整洁的姓名: def get_formatted_name(first_name, last_name): full_name = first_name...) Jimi Hendrix 在需要分别存储大量名和姓的大型程序中,像get_formatted_name()这样的函数非常有用。
” 如同大部分故事都会有结局,绝大多数函数也都是以返回结果作为结束。函数返回结果的手法,决定了调用它时的体验。所以,了解如何优雅的让函数返回结果,是编写好函数的必备知识。...Python 的函数返回方式 Python 函数通过调用 return 语句来返回结果。...return User.filter(is_active=True) # 返回单个用户get_users(user_id=1)# 返回多个用户get_users() 当我们需要获取单个用户时,就传递...像上面的例子,我们应该编写两个独立的函数 get_user_by_id(user_id)、 get_active_users()来替代。 2....抛出异常,而不是返回结果与错误 我在前面提过,Python 里的函数可以返回多个值。基于这个能力,我们可以编写一类特殊的函数:同时返回结果与错误信息的函数。
为了更好地说明如何返回异步调用的结果,先看三个尝试异步调用的示例吧。...) { result = response }) return result // 返回:undefined } 毫无意外这个示例的调用结果也是undefined。...因为这三个示例涉及的三个操作————ajax、fetch、readFile都是异步操作,从操作指令发出,到拿到结果,这中间有一个时间间隔。无论你的机器性能多么强劲,这个间隔也无法完全抹掉。...回调函数:最古老的异步结果返回方式 先看示例一,使用回调函数改写: function foo(callback) { $.ajax({ url: "......小结 在JS中处理异步调用的结果,最佳实践就是“异步转同步”:使用Promise + async/await语法关键字。
例如以下3中TYPE是等价的。 kubectl get pod pod1 kubectl get pods pod1 kubectl get po pod1 NAME:资源对象的名称,区分大小写。...如果不指定名称,系统则将返回属于TYPE的全部对象的列表,例如:kubectl get pods 将返回所有 pod 的列表 flags: kubectl 子命令的可选参数,例如使用 -s 指定api...kubectl可操作的资源对象类型以及缩写: 在一个命令行中也可以同时对多个资源对象进行操作,以多个TYPE和NAME的组合表示,示例如下: 获取多个pod的信息: kubectl get pods...-f 3、查看所有Pod列表 kubectl get pods 4、查看rc和service列表 kubectl get rc,service 5、显示Node的详细信息 kubectl...的日志 kubectl logs 15、跟踪查看容器的日志,相当于tail -f命令的结果 kubectl logs -f -c <container-name
现在碰到过一些结果后面的操作适合用到,所以这里就拿出来用一下,并且复习一下落下的知识。 概念: 基本概念这个博主解释的比较清楚,如果有不懂的可以去看一下。...就是主要的切面方法,用于对返回值进行判断并且进行对应的操作,这样可以不用再每个方法中都写一次。 ...root.get("resultCode").toString().equals("0")) { // 返回数据异常 throw new ResultErrorException...("WebService 返回结果异常:" + root.toString()); } } @Before("picter()") public void before...point.getArgs() 结果: 红框内容就是AOP自动添加的。
notin(front,back) Env=dev tie in (front,back),Env=dev(与关系) 实操 查看 Pod kubectl get pods 查看一下 Pod...打的标签 kubectl get pods —show-labels 查看 Pod 具体的资源信息 kubectl get pods nginx1 -o yaml 新增标签 kubectl...label pods nginx1 env=test 修改标签 kubectl label pods nginx1 env=test —overwrite 删除标签 kubectl label...pods nginx1 env- 通过label筛选 kubectl get pods --show-labels -l env=prod kubectl get pods --show-labels...-o yaml 控制器模式 控制循环 spec 和 status 不一致时触发 各组件独立自主运行 不断使系统向终态趋近 status -> spec 详细流程 Sensor 传感器 控制循环中逻辑的传感器主要由
Oracle存储过程: CREATE OR REPLACE PROCEDURE getcity ( citycode IN VARCHA...
例如,以下命令输出的结果相同: kubectl get pods nginx kubectl get pod nginx kubectl get po nginx NAME 指定资源的名称,名称区分大小写...例如 kubectl get pods flags 指定可选的参数。...kubectl get pods -o wide 查看一个资源类型中的多个资源(查看命名空间为kube-system下的指定pod) kubectl get pod -n kube-system calico-node...nginx app=mypod 根据标签查询POD: kubectl get pods --show-labels kubectl delete pods -l app=mypod 删除所有(包括未初始化的...从pod返回日志快照 kubectl logs 从pod中开启流式传输日志,类似于tail -f的linux指令 kubectl logs -f 7 格式化输出
最近在数据库处理的时候发现日期对比的时候没有返回正确的结果。 但是保存的时间实际上是相同的。 代码如下: if (!...问题解决 经过 Debug 后,这 2 个日期的纳秒数是不同的,查看下对象如下。 我们会发现其中一个对象有纳秒,一个对象没有。 但是 fastTime 是相同的。...如果使用 equals 那么这个方法比较的是毫秒,所以是不相等的。 因为多了一个 0。 如上图显示的毫秒比较,因此这里不能使用这个比较方法。...dbDateTime.isEqual(mlsDateTime)) { } 说白了这个问题就是精度的问题。 https://www.ossez.com/t/java/13833
-06 uncordoned 等待gitlab pod running 后 将k8s-node-06节点恢复不可调度 [root@k8s-master-01 ~]# kubectl get...-01 ~]# kubectl get nodes 2. describe Evicted pod 定位解决 [root@k8s-master-01 ~]# kubectl describe pods...gitlab-84d4998c96-b6z2j -n kube-ops 注: pod名词不一致 忽略。...如下: kubectl get pods --all-namespaces -o json | jq '.items[] | select(.status.reason!...metadata.namespace)"' | xargs -n 1 bash -c 总结: 做好资源的监控 kubectl命令的熟练掌握,高效运用 当然了最重要的还是处理问题的思路。
get pods -n kube-ops [root@k8s-master-01 ~]# kubectl cordon k8s-node-06 node/k8s-node-06 cordoned [root...@k8s-master-01 ~]# kubectl get nodes [image.png] 2. describe Evicted pod 定位解决 [root@k8s-master-01 ~]#...kubectl describe pods gitlab-84d4998c96-b6z2j -n kube-ops 注: pod名词不一致 忽略。...如下: kubectl get pods --all-namespaces -o json | jq '.items[] | select(.status.reason!...metadata.namespace)"' | xargs -n 1 bash -c 总结: 做好资源的监控 kubectl命令的熟练掌握,高效运用 当然了最重要的还是处理问题的思路。
原因: 这是一种表与索引之间的逻辑不一致。这种逻辑不一致通常是因为表上的高水位(HWM)出现了问题,全表扫描比索引扫描返回了更少的行。...这种不一致性也可能是由于Oracle的defect或会引起IO丢失的OS/硬件问题导致的。...如果从Oracle Support需要额外的帮助,请提供: 1. analyze语句分析的trace文件。 2. 第一个查询语句的结果。 3. dump基表段头产生的trace文件。...这个查询结果可以明确索引多返回的行的区id: select rid, a.relative_fno, a.block, e.owner, e.segment_name, e.segment_type...- 表空间是上述步骤3提供的。 - 这个SQL查询提供了索引返回行位置的区extent。
领取专属 10元无门槛券
手把手带您无忧上云